The area of a circle with a diameter of 6 inches is approximately

Answer:

Area ≈ 28.27 inches²

Explanation:

To find the area of a circle, we first need to know the following formula:

Area of a circle = π r²

The radius of a circle is always half of the diameter. With this, we can determine that the radius of this circle is 3. All that is left is to input the value of the radius into our formula.

Area of a circle = π r²

A = π (3)²

A = π (9)

A ≈ 28.27 inches²
